Welcome to the GalleryWhisper audio-guide team. Before running the app locally, you must configure the narration service connection. The staging narration servers at the Hollowmere Museum deployment reject any client without a valid service token, so double-check your .env file carefully before your first sync. Add the following line to your .env, exactly as issued by the platform team.

env line for kageg-fajof: COURIER_KEY5=93d14

Ticket: Signature check failed on relevance-tuning bundle

The Searchwick relevance tuning notes bundle (synonym weights, decay curves) failed verification on promote — stale key in the verifier. Tuning content itself is fine; no re-index needed. Please re-sign the bundle and redeploy the pipeline. Current valid signing key for this release follows.

deploy key for kajof-fajop: bky6_gDHw9Q

// MAX_PIN_AGE_DAYS
//
// Per the Dovecote pinning policy: all third-party deps in
// the Skerrit monorepo must be refreshed within this window
// or CI blocks merges. 90 days for now; security wants 60.
// Discuss at sync before changing — last tightening broke
// four teams overnight. The policy build this shipped with
// is stamped below.

session token of bawep-yadup = htk21_528abd376e3c5a4ec24a1